Why the eye confuses redet with rüde

These two trip readers on the page rather than in the ear: redet is [ˈʁeːdət] while rüde is [ˈʁyːdə]. Spoken aloud the problem disappears. In writing it persists, because they differ by 1 letter(s) in length, and the parts of speech differ too (verb vs adjective), which is usually the fastest check. Frequently Asked Questions

Is swapping "redet" for "rüde" ever safe?
No - they are not even the same part of speech. "redet" is a verb and "rüde" an adjective, so a sentence built for one is usually ungrammatical with the other.
Which is more common, "redet" or "rüde"?
"redet" is the more common of the two: it sits at frequency rank #2,739 in our German list, against #31,254 for "rüde". That is a wide gap, so in ordinary text the rarer spelling is the one worth double-checking.
